(2007-03-02) Taleb Black Swan

Nassim Taleb's Black Swan ISBN:1400063515 is coming out in a couple months. A black swan is a highly improbable event with three principal characteristics: It is unpredictable; it carries a massive impact; and, after the fact, we concoct an explanation that makes it appear less random, and more predictable, than it was. The astonishing success of Google was a Black Swan; so was 9/11 (World Trade Center). For Nassim Nicholas Taleb, black swans underlie almost everything about our world, from the rise of religions to events in our own personal lives.
